The Story Behind Ukeh
The name Ukeh is rooted in the Igbo language and culture of West Africa, specifically Nigeria. It is a traditional name given to the firstborn son in a family. This practice of naming children based on their birth order or circumstances is common in many African cultures, and the name Ukeh carries with it the significance of being the inaugural male heir, often implying a position of responsibility and honor within the family structure. Its usage reflects the cultural value placed on lineage and the continuation of the family name.
